BIT ALLOCATION ALGORITHMS FOR FREQUENCY AND TIME SPREAD PERCEPTUAL CODING |
| Authors: |
Ricky Der; McGill University | | |
| | Peter Kabal; McGill University | | |
| | Wai-Yip Chan; Queen's University | | |
| Abstract: |
We examine the problem of bit allocation in a constant-distortion coding context, whentime-spread and frequency-spread perceptual distortion criteria are used. For such measures,standard incremental techniques can fail. Two algorithms are introduced for bit allocation;the first a multi-band version of the greedy algorithm, and the second an inverse greedyalgorithm initialized by the bit allocation of a forward algorithm driven by a non-spreadmetric. Experimental results show the second algorithm outperforms the first. |
